Woodward, Tessa – System, 1989
Presents a small informal survey assessing the awareness of input styles of English-as-a-Foreign-Language teacher trainers. The survey proved to have a beneficial effect on both questioner and questioned, and enhanced trainers' self-awareness and trainer-to-trainer attitude changes. (Author/CB)

Fisher, Jean; Bjorner, Susanne – Special Libraries, 1994
Examines the librarian's role in managing online access and training endusers based on a survey of librarians. Highlights include the impact on special libraries; goals of enduser training; the corporate context; instructional and training aids; enduser instruction in the virtual library; and competencies required for information literacy.
